Marranitos, also known as cochinitos or puerquitos, are traditional Mexican pig-shaped cookies that are popular during the Christmas season and other special occasions. These delicious treats are a beloved part of Mexican cuisine and are enjoyed by people of all ages.
The name "marranitos" translates to "little pigs" in English, and it's easy to see why these cookies got their name. Shaped like cute little pigs, these cookies are not only fun to look at but also incredibly tasty. They are made with a combination of molasses, cinnamon, and other spices, giving them a warm, sweet, and slightly spicy flavor.
Despite their playful appearance, marranitos have a long history in Mexican culinary tradition and are often made in family kitchens and local bakeries. They are a staple in Mexican bakeries and are enjoyed with a cup of hot chocolate or coffee.
